
THE FINEST CHOICE Author: Jean Rabe ISBN: 0765308215 9/2005 FANTASY Publisher: TOR
Jean Rabe's sequel to THE FINEST CREATION is called THE FINEST CHOICE. Although I really don't think it's necessary to read the first book in the series, it does help make the book more enjoyable. I was quite pleasantly surprised as to how much I liked THE FINEST CHOICE. What drew me to this book was the whole premise of the story—forged creatures masquerading as horses bonding with mortals while guiding and protecting them on their path of enlightenment. I'm not a big fan of the fantasy genre, but THE FINEST CHOICE is a rare find among a lot of fantasy books out there. I know, because I have definitely read my fair share of them *G*. The main characters: Gallant-Stallion and Kalantha (even though one is a horse and the other a young girl) are wonderfully written. I found myself drawn to Kalantha, a young girl having to suddenly deal with the temptations and the cruelties of the real world. If that isn't bad enough, her brother, Meven, is in great danger and it's up to her and her Finest to help save him. I would recommend reading Jean Rabe's THE FINEST CHOICE, especially if you enjoy fantasy books! Julie Kornhausl |
